Q. How is Vedic ghee different from regular A2 ghee?

A. While both come from A2 milk, Vedic Ghee goes a step further. The cows are not just grass-fed—they’re nourished with medicinal herbs known in Ayurveda to enhance the sattvic (pure) quality of milk. The preparation process is also rooted in Ayurvedic principles, often using earthen pots or cooking over cow dung cakes for better energy retention.


Q. Is Vedic ghee safe for everyday use?

A. Absolutely. In fact, it’s encouraged in small daily quantities. A spoon of Vedic ghee can be drizzled over your food, had with warm water in the morning, or used in Ayurvedic detox practices like snehapana or nasya.


Q. What kind of cows is your Vedic ghee made from?

A. Our Vedic ghee is made from the milk of indigenous Indian desi cows, known for their hump-backed structure (Surya Ketu Nadi) and ability to produce A2 milk. These cows are naturally more resistant to disease and are not crossbred or injected with hormones ensuring purity and bioavailable nutrition.


Q. What is the role of Ayurvedic herbs in the cow's diet?

A. Cows are fed herbs like Ashwagandha, Shatavari, Giloy, and Tulsi — not just for their health, but because these herbs infuse the milk with medicinal properties. Ayurveda believes that when cows consume these herbs, the ghee made from their milk carries their benefits too, making it a therapeutic food rather than just a fat.
